WHIP HOORAY Dettori will make big day rides

- By DAVID YATES

FRANKIE DETTORI says he will “play my joker” to ride on Ascot’s QIPCO British Champions Day card after picking up two whip bans at Longchamp last weekend.

Dettori is assured a stellar book of mounts on Britain’s richest raceday, including Palace Pier for boss John Gosden (inset) in the £1.1m Group One Queen Elizabeth II Stakes.

The Italian received a two-day suspension for his winning effort aboard Loving Dream in Saturday’s Prix Royallieu, and a four-day ban after partnering Grand Glory to a nose defeat by Rougir in the

Prix de l’opera.

The punishment­s cover the Champions Day fixture on Saturday week but Dettori said yesterday: “I’m going to play my joker.

“As one of the bans was for two days, my manager will email France Galop to move the days, and then France Galop will contact the British Horseracin­g

Authority. Once they have told them that I want to move the days, I will be okay to ride at Ascot.”

Dettori is confident next year’s QIPCO 1000 Guineas favourite Inspiral can take the step up to the top-level when she crosses swords with eight rivals in tomorrow’s Group One bet365 Fillies’ Mile at Newmarket.

The daughter of Frankel is as short as 5-1 market leader for the Rowley Mile Classic next May after adding Doncaster’s Group Two May Hill Stakes to wins at Sandown Park and Newmarket.

“She is not the finished article by any means,” said Dettori. “She has done nothing wrong so far, she has got a great physique and lots of scope, and she is taking the usual progressio­n after winning a Group Two to have a go at a Group One.”

Inspiral is a best-priced 10-11 for tomorrow’s test.
